CNDT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

321 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Conduent (CNDT)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$3.5B — down 4.9% from $3.68B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 39 funds closed out of CNDT and 38 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 97 trimmed existing stakes and 110 added.

The largest buyer was Rubric Capital Management (New York), adding an estimated $24.7M. The largest seller was Frontier Capital Management, cutting an estimated $47.4M.
